The Night Before Christmas

Twas the night before Christmas that was freezing cold As a seven year old I couldn’t keep excitement on the hold For I knew for me all the lovely gifts Santa would bring Wished the hours of night fly away quickly on their wing. I had heard that Santa would come through the chimney If there was one on our house roof, I wanted myself to see I had rushed to the roof-top terrace, but didn’t find one but Mom told me he’d come through the window for fun. At bed time I didn’t let Mom close the window of my room Outside the chilled wind from the snowfield I heard zoom In the morn saw the gifts by my side, I tried to shout in delight But couldn’t as the voice was choked by cold I caught at night.
